Sec. 5. Extended benefit eligibility for children who are full-time students

Section 202(d) of the Social Security Act ( 42 U.S.C. 402(d) ) is amended— in paragraphs (1)(B), (1)(E), (1)(F)(i), (1)(G)(ii), (6)(A), (6)(D), (6)(E)(i), (7)(A), (7)(B), and (7)(D), by striking full-time elementary or secondary school student each place it appears and inserting full-time student ; in paragraphs (1)(B), (1)(F)(ii), (1)(G)(iii), (6)(A), (6)(D), (6)(E)(ii), and (7)(D), by striking 19 each place it appears and inserting 23 ; in subparagraphs (A), (B), and
(D)of paragraph (7), by striking elementary or secondary school each place it appears and inserting educational institution ; in paragraph (7)(A), by striking schools involved and inserting institutions involved ; in paragraph (7), by amending subparagraph
(C)to read as follows: For purposes of this subsection, the term educational institution means— a school which provides elementary or secondary education as determined under the law of the State or other jurisdiction in which it is located; and an institution described in section 102 of the Higher Education Act of 1965 ( 20 U.S.C. 1002 ). ; and in paragraph (7)(D), by striking diploma or equivalent certificate from a secondary school (as defined in subparagraph (C)(i)) and inserting diploma, degree, or equivalent certificate from an institution described in subparagraph (C)(ii) . Section 2(d) of the Railroad Retirement Act of 1974 (45 U.S.C. 232(2)(d)) is amended— in clause
(iii)of paragraph (1), by striking will be less than nineteen years of age and a full-time elementary or secondary school student and inserting will be less than 23 years of age and a full-time student at an educational institution (as defined in section 202(d)(7) of the Social Security Act) ; and in paragraph (4)— by striking elementary or secondary school each place it appears and inserting educational institution ; by striking nineteen and inserting 23 ; and by striking a diploma or equivalent certificate from a secondary school (as defined in section 202(d)(7)(c)(i) of the Social Security Act) and inserting a diploma, degree, or equivalent certificate from an institution described in section 202(d)(7)(C)(ii) of the Social Security Act . Section 5(c)(7) of the Railroad Retirement Act of 1974 ( 45 U.S.C. 235(c)(7) ) is amended— by striking elementary or secondary school and inserting educational institution ; and by striking 19 and inserting 23 . The amendments made by this section shall apply to child's insurance benefits that are payable for months beginning after December 31, 2019.
